Jimwell shines like gem for Bulls

-

For Jimwell Torion, bowing out of the PBA All-Filipino Cup is one thing. Doing it in style is another.

The 5-foot-8 Red Bull playmaker was named Player of the Week by the PBA Press Corps for the period covering April 24-30 after powering his team to back-to-back wins over Pop Cola and San Miguel Beer.

The Cebuano hotshot edged teammate Devonn Harp, who could have won the honors himself or even shared it with Torion with the kind of numbers he put up in the same stretch.

But it was too difficult to ignore the heroics of the Red Bull point guard, who took over for the Energy Kings when they needed them most and scored the crucial baskets that counted most down the stretch.

"Even if he is not your traditional point-guard because he loves to shoot a lot, I still believe that with Jimwell around, that position is no longer a problem of our team," said Red Bull coach Yeng Guiao.

Torion averaged 17.5 points in the last two games, scoring the key baskets in spectacular fashions as Red Bull pulled off a 78-75 win over Pop Cola last Wednesday and a 92-88 victory over San Miguel two nights ago.

"Gusto ko talagang mag-take charge sa fourth quarter," said Torion, who looks up to Philadelphia 76ers' point guard Allen Iverson, whose style he loves to emulate.

Both Iverson and Torion are non-traditional point-guards who look to score more often than to pass. In fact, Harp, who dished out a triple-double performance, led the Energizers in assists over the past two games, averaging nine, a far cry from the 1.5 assists Torion logged over the same stretch.
